Okay, we were playing an apocalypse game yesterday, Eldar + Ork Vs Ultras + Imperial Guard making 8000 points on each side by using bits and pieces from all out armies.
This is what happened and the people I was playing disputed something and I want to know what you lot think....
One of my Farseer's used doom a full squad of assault marines
A round of pitiful shooting from my dire avengers killed only one marine
A mob of my allies boys assault the marines
He roll's well on his "to hit" rolls but badly on his "to wound" roll
I remind him that the squad he's attacking is doomed so he can re-roll them.
One of my opponents disputes this and says doom should only effect Eldar pieces.
The codex says "all hits caused upon that unit gain a re-roll to wound until the start of the next Eldar turn"
This would suggest my view was right and that my allies could re-roll to wound against the doomed squad, but still my opponent complained and refused to let us take a re-roll.
Him being a good friend and unfortunately VERY stubborn and a awful looser, me and my orky ally let it go.
What do you guys think should have happened? The RAW don't disprove the point i was arguing, so what do you lot think?

Gorechild wrote:we weren't really happy with it we were just letting the baby have its bottle as it were
but just theoretically, do you think my view is correct?
No view is more or less correct because 40K isn't written (outside of the ally rules in the WH/ DH codex) for having multiple players with multiple different army types on each side.
So you should decide before the game whether or not your special rules apply to your allies armies or not. That's part of playing Apocalypse is that you just have to figure out the odd situations you run into.
When it comes to different armies sharing abilities with each other there are basically three ways you can decide to play when the ability doesn't exactly specify who it benefits (such as 'all friendly units' for example):
1) Rule that it ONLY benefits the player's army who is using the ability.
2) Rule that it benefits other friendly armies, but ONLY if they are from the same codex (so two Eldar players on the same team would both benefit from each other's special rules).
3) Rule that ALL friendly players benefit from these types of special rules.
Once you've agreed which way you are going to play, then just apply it to any special rule that is slightly unclear about who it affects and you shouldn't have any more problems.

As has been said, cross-army abilities is something not covered by the rules.
What I commonly see is that abilities targetting friendly units can only be used on the same army (no using guide on devestators or having scorpions get an extra attack from Pedro Cantor) but abilities which target enemy units are in force for everyone (so doom would have been fine)
